New Horizons Funding Announced

January 26, 2009

MP Greg Kerr announces federal investment of close to $19,000 for seniors’ project in Annapolis Royal

ANNAPOLIS ROYAL, NS
– Today Greg Kerr, Member of Parliament for West Nova, announced funding for the Annapolis Royal Historic Gardens Society as part of the New Horizons for Seniors Program, provided by the Government of Canada.

On behalf of the Honourable Diane Finley, Minister of Human Resources and Skills Development, and the Honourable Diane Ablonczy, Minister of State for Seniors, Mr. Kerr announced $18,610 in funding for the organization under the Community Participation and Leadership component of the New Horizons for Seniors Program.

“I am proud to announce that our Government is continuing to support local seniors’ projects,” said Mr. Kerr. “Federal funding towards this project will help allow seniors in Annapolis Royal to increase their participation in the community.”

The Annapolis Royal Historic Gardens Society will receive funding for its project; Growing Active Seniors at the Historic Gardens. Through this project, seniors will develop and deliver a volunteer program at the Historic Gardens and plan, develop and enhance community gardening opportunities and participation for Seniors in the Gardens, thus reducing isolation and enhancing their involvement in the community.

“This federal funding will enable us to undertake an exciting new project involving seniors at the Gardens,” said Keith Crysler, Chair of the Board of directors at the Annapolis Royal Historic Gardens Society. “We greatly appreciate the support for our project from Mr. Kerr and the Government of Canada.”
